职工工资管理系统设计与开发程序
时间: 2024-06-22 08:03:30 浏览: 206
职工工资管理系统是企业用于管理员工薪酬、福利、考勤等信息的信息化工具。设计与开发这样的程序通常包括以下几个关键步骤:
1. 需求分析:首先,明确系统需要处理的功能,比如工资计算(基本工资、绩效奖金、津贴等)、薪酬结构设置、考勤管理、假期管理、税务处理等。还要考虑权限管理、数据安全和报表生成。
2. 设计阶段:
- 数据库设计:创建员工信息表、薪资结构表、考勤记录表等,确保数据结构合理且易于查询。
- 界面设计:直观易用的用户界面,支持不同角色(如管理员、财务人员)访问相应的功能模块。
- 系统架构:选择合适的开发框架(如Java、C#、Python等),决定是否采用B/S架构或C/S架构。
3. 开发实现:
- 前端开发:使用HTML、CSS、JavaScript或现代前端框架(如React、Vue)构建用户界面,实现数据输入、显示和交互。
- 后端开发:编写服务器端代码,处理用户请求、数据库操作、业务逻辑等。
- 安全性:实施适当的安全措施,如数据加密、身份验证、访问控制等。
4. 测试与调试:对系统进行全面测试,确保功能正常、性能良好,并修复可能出现的错误。
5. 部署与维护:将系统部署到服务器,进行必要的配置和优化。同时,提供持续的维护和支持,根据业务需求进行更新和升级。
阅读全文